9種常用的uml圖總結(jié) um l通信圖作用?
um l通信圖作用?UML即Unified Model Language,是一種建模語言,又是標(biāo)準(zhǔn)建模語言。在軟件開發(fā)中,當(dāng)系統(tǒng)規(guī)模比較緊張時,需要用圖形抽象的概念地來怎樣表達(dá)緊張的概念,讓整個軟件設(shè)
um l通信圖作用?
UML即Unified Model Language,是一種建模語言,又是標(biāo)準(zhǔn)建模語言。在軟件開發(fā)中,當(dāng)系統(tǒng)規(guī)模比較緊張時,需要用圖形抽象的概念地來怎樣表達(dá)緊張的概念,讓整個軟件設(shè)計更具備可讀性,可理解性,盡快及早發(fā)現(xiàn)軟件設(shè)計時未知的潛在動機(jī)問題,最終達(dá)到降低開發(fā)風(fēng)險。同樣的,也更大地更方便了業(yè)務(wù)人員與開發(fā)人員之間的聯(lián)系。
uml消息的組成包括?
UML由視圖(View)圖(Diagram)模型元素(Model Element)和通用機(jī)制(General Mechanism)等幾部分混編。
uml協(xié)作圖用什么軟件?
VisualParadigm編輯的話工具界面簡潔,提示模糊,容易上手。
程序員是怎么保持代碼框架清晰整潔的?
另外所接觸程序5年的程序員來分享一下個人的經(jīng)驗(yàn)
多讀寫代碼那像學(xué)會說話一般,必須多看別人是怎摸寫的,比如github上面很多開源的最優(yōu)秀代碼,有意識地怎么學(xué)習(xí)代碼風(fēng)格、代碼結(jié)構(gòu)和注釋,要讓你漸漸地潛移默化的提高自己的代碼能力。
多想很多情況下,初學(xué)者很容易犯一個錯誤——焦急寫代碼卻就沒把代碼思路想好。最好的方法是建議在寫代碼之前把框架、步驟和邏輯好好想,可以把它可以寫成注釋放在文件的開頭,那樣這個時候叮囑自己的思路清晰,并且絕對不會因?yàn)橹虚g隔一段時間沒寫就不記得之前的思路。
多練多看多想之后是多練,很多習(xí)慣比如說代碼注釋、代碼風(fēng)格都需要在不停地練習(xí)和實(shí)踐當(dāng)中能得到鍛煉和進(jìn)步,所以才多寫代碼,也是可以讓大家相互來參與codereview,再討論過程中都是他對各方面能力的提升!
管框架的人要不斷總結(jié)遇到的新問題,在不徹底破壞框架各部分主體職責(zé)界限的情況下,該如何作盡量多調(diào)整以認(rèn)同自己新的變更。同樣要隨著業(yè)務(wù)量的變化來識別框架的性能瓶頸,并在定位到瓶頸時出具評估報告框架的堅固的城墻程度。當(dāng)只能無奈畢竟性能而變化框架時,最好不要一直保持以前框架職責(zé)界限變,界定新的職責(zé),使把那個框架的局部的或整體通過分離的過程與合并。
在講框架各部分職責(zé)及界限時,盡量遠(yuǎn)遠(yuǎn)離開編程技術(shù)術(shù)語語境,用已經(jīng)不不需要程序技能就能懂的概念和語言來組織描述??隙ǎ粚儆谛阅芤髸r不可避免要要用技術(shù)語言。
框架無論有多奇怪,都那些要求能在一張圖上背景介紹地向各方相關(guān)人員講清楚。當(dāng)碰到必須根據(jù)情況框架時,這張圖可以為了指導(dǎo)你努力必要的資源。